<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Actors <strong>Anya Taylor-Joy</strong>, <strong>Colman Domingo</strong>, <strong>Hamilton</strong>, <strong>Jason Rodriguez</strong>, <strong>MJ Rodriguez</strong>, <strong>Pedro Pascal </strong>and <strong>Rosie Perez </strong>stand out among the nominees for the inaugural Hollywood Critics Association TV Awards. Other notable candidates with Latino connections are the series <em>Selena + Chef</em>, <em>Superstore </em>and the film <em>Hamilton.&nbsp;</em></p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Founded in 2016, HCA’s mission is to “Bring together a passionate group of critics and journalists who represent the voices of a new era in Hollywood.” Formerly known as the Los Angeles Online Film Critics Society until 2019, the group has presented film awards since 2017. This is the first time it hands out television awards, which also include streaming platform categories.</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ignleft size-large is-resized"><img dec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/12/Colman-Domino-CROPPED-783x460.png" alt="" class="wp-image-57701" width="332" height="195"/><figcaption>Colman Domingo</figcaption></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y is nominated for her role in Netflix’s <em>The Queen’s Gambit </em>in the category of Best Actress in a Limited Series, Anthology Series or Television Movie. Taylor-Joy’s orphaned chess prodigy Beth Harmon has earned her various accolades, including a SAG Award and a Golden Globe.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Domingo got a nod for his role in HBO’s <em>Euphoria Two-Part Special </em>for Best Actor in a Limited Series, Anthology Series or Television Movie.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The film <em>Hamilton </em>competes for Best Streaming Limited Series, Anthology Series or Live-Action Television Movie. The Disney+ feature, starring and written by <strong>Lin-Manuel Miranda</strong>, captures the live performance on Broadway with the original cast of the multiple Tony Award-winning musical America&#8217;s founding father <strong>Alexander Hamilton</strong>.</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ignright size-full is-resized"><img dec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2014/08/PedroPasquel.jpg" alt="" class="wp-image-20780" width="206" height="275"/><figcaption>Pedro Pascal</figcaption></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Two Latino actors from the FX’s <em>Pose </em>contend in two different categories. Jason Rodriguez and MJ Rodriguez vie for Best Supporting Actor and Best Actress in a Broadcast Network or Cable Series, Drama, respectively.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Pascal scores his fourth award nomination for his leading role in <em>The Mandalorian</em>. He is nominated for Best Actor in a Streaming Series, Drama category for his role in Disney+’s sci-fi series.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Academy Award-nominee Rosie Perez gets a nom for Best Supporting Actress in a Streaming Series, Comedy for her role in HBO Max’s <em>The Flight Attendant</em>.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><em>Selena + Chef</em>, the HBO Max that features singer/actress <strong>Selena Gomez</strong>, competes for Best Cable or Streaming Reality Series, Competition Series, or Game Show.&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">And <em>Superstore</em>, the NBC comedy series starring and executive produced by <strong>America Ferrera</strong>, nabbed a total of three noms, including Best Broadcast Network Series, Comedy.&nbsp;</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ignleft size-large is-resized"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/04/Mj-Rodriguez-783x460.jpg" alt="" class="wp-image-63567" width="260" height="153"/><figcaption>MJ Rodriguez</figcaption></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">NBC has a total of 29 nominations, the most out of all of the traditional broadcast networks with. Its popular series <em>Zoey’s Extraordinary Playlist, Young Rock, Superstore, Mr. Mayor </em>and <em>This is Us</em> all boast multiple noms.<br /><br />HBO leads the Cable categories, also with a total of 29 nods. <em>Mare of Easttown, I May Destroy You, the Euphoria Two-Part Special </em>and <em>The Undoing</em> have multiple nods. The cable channel’s streaming counterpart HBO Max also received various noms with <em>Hacks</em> and <em>The Flight Attendant</em> gathering the most.&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">As more and more networks have started to expand into streaming, Netflix continues to lead the way with a total of 28 nominations spread across multiple categories including Best Streaming Docuseries, Documentary Television Movie, or Non-Fiction Series. <em>The Crown</em> received the most nominations of all the Netflix submissions with a total of six nods, including Best Streaming Series, Drama.&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The HCA TV Awards ceremony will be held at the Avalon Hollywood in Los Angeles Aug. 22.</p><p>The post <a href="https://latinheat.com/latinos-well-represented-in-nods-for-hollywood-critics-association-tv-awards/">Latinos Well Represented in Nods for Hollywood Critics Association TV Awards</a> first appeared on <a href="https://latinheat.com"></a>.</p>]]></content:encoded>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>Anya Taylor-Joy</strong> (<em>The Queen’s Gambit</em>) continues her reign in psychological horror films with <em>Last Night in Soho</em>.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The mind-bending film follows Eloise, played by <strong>Thomasin McKenzie</strong>, an upcoming fashion designer who mysteriously travels to 1960s London. However, when Eloise travels to the past, she isn’t herself, she becomes Taylor-Joy’s Sandy, a beautiful singer. The mesmerizing neon lights quickly turn sinister when the past attempts to cross over. </p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The film was initially slated to release in 2020, but was delayed due to the pandemic. Golden Globe-winner Taylor-Joy is no stranger to psychological thrillers. She’s previously starred in <em>Split</em>, <em>The Witch </em>and <em>Glass</em>.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><em>Last Night in Soho </em>was directed by <strong>Edgar Wright </strong>(<em>Baby Driver</em>) and is set to release in October 2021.</p><p>The post <a href="https://latinheat.com/trailer-anya-taylor-jo-in-last-night-in-soho/">Trailer: Anya Taylor-Joy In ‘Last Night in Soho’</a> first appeared on <a href="https://latinheat.com"></a>.</p>]]></content:encoded>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Adding another coveted honor to her resume for her performance in&nbsp;<em>The Queen’s Gambit</em>, actress&nbsp;<strong>Anya Taylor-Joy&nbsp;</strong>walked away with a Screen Actors Guild Award yesterday during the airing of the virtual awards show on the TBS and TNT networks.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">She was up against some Hollywood heavy-hitters like <strong>Cate Blanchett,</strong> <strong>Kerry Washington</strong>, <strong>Michaela Coel</strong> and <strong>Nicole Kidman</strong> who were also nominated in her category.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y, who looked stunning in a black lace Vera Wang dress, was awarded the Outstanding Performance by a Female Actor in a Miniseries or Television Movie SAG Award for playing Beth Harmon, the orphaned chess prodigy in the hit Netflix series. In&nbsp;<em>The Queen’s Gambit,&nbsp;</em>Harmon was not only a fierce chess player, she was also somewhat of a fashionista, a similar trait that seems to be shared by Taylor-Joy’s as here fans pointed out on social media.&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">“I’m so unbelievably honored to be in this room. Even though it’s not a room, it’s still mental. It was such a privilege to get to work with the playmakers I got to work with, “Taylor-Joy said during her acceptance speech. “They were so beautiful and supportive and kind. A show isn’t made by one person, it’s made by everybody, and I’m just so, so grateful that I get to do this.”</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">For the 24-year-old, Miami-born Taylor-Joy, a British-American actress who is of Argentine descent, the SAG Award is the fourth honor she receives for her performance in&nbsp;<em>The Queen’s Gambit</em>. She recently received a Golden Globes for best actress in a limited series or TV movie. Internationally she also received an AACTA International Award and the Broadcast Film Critics Association Award for the role.</p>


<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/04/Anya-Taylor-Joy-Wearing-Vera-Wang-719x460.png" alt="" class="wp-image-62290"/><figcaption>Anya Taylor-Joy wearig a Vera Wang dress (Photo:  Glamfendi Instagram)</figcaption></figure>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y first came to prominence in the 2015 fantasy series&nbsp;<em>Atlantis</em>. Accolades started to roll in that same year with&nbsp;<em>The Witch</em>, a period horror film that won the actress nine film festival prizes. Other recent movies that have brought her recognition are&nbsp;<em>Glass</em>,&nbsp;<em>Marrowbone</em>, and&nbsp;<em>Thoroughbreds</em>.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The only other Latinos awarded at the SAG Award were part of the 160 stunt performer ensemble for&nbsp;<em>Wonder Woman 1984</em>, including&nbsp;<strong>Carlos Castillo</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Dacio Diaz Caballero</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Eduardo Gago</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Mauro Calo</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Pablo Verdejo</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Ramon Alvarez&nbsp;</strong>and&nbsp;<strong>Richard Nunez</strong>. Also,&nbsp;<strong>Joe Perez&nbsp;</strong>stands out among 20 performers in&nbsp;<em>The Mandalorian’s</em>&nbsp;winning stunt group,&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">This year’s SAG winners include&nbsp;<strong>Chadwick Boseman</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Viola Davis</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Daniel Kaluuya&nbsp;</strong>and&nbsp;<strong>Yuh-Jung Youn&nbsp;</strong>for performances in motion pictures, and&nbsp;<strong>Mark Ruffalo</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Jason Bateman</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Gillian Anderson</strong>,&nbsp;<strong>Jason Sudeikis&nbsp;</strong>and&nbsp;<strong>Catherine O’Hara&nbsp;</strong>for performances in television. The SAG awards for outstanding performances by a motion picture cast went this year to film&nbsp;<em>The Trial of the Chicago 7</em>, while the award for television drama and comedy ensemble performances went to the series&nbsp;<em>The Crown</em>&nbsp;and&nbsp;<em>Schitt’s Creek</em>.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>Anya Taylor-Joy </strong>has won the Golden Globes for best actress in a limited series or TV movie for her lead in Netflix’s <em>The Queen’s Gambit,</em><strong> </strong>about an orphaned chess prodigy.</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ignright size-large is-resized"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/03/the-queens-gambit.jpg" alt="" class="wp-image-60782" width="440" height="247"/></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The 24-year-old actress of Argentine descent defeated past Golden Globe and Academy Award winners <strong>Cate Blanchett </strong>and <strong>Nicole Kidman</strong>, who competed for their roles in <em>Mrs. America</em><strong> </strong>and <em>The Undoing</em>, respectively. Taylor-Joy acknowledged both acclaimed actresses in her acceptance speech. She also prevailed over <em>Normal People</em>’s <strong>Daisy Edgar-Jones </strong>and <em>Unorthodox</em>’s Shira Haas, both of whom—like Taylor-Joy—were first time Golden Globe nominees.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">However, in the case of <em>The Queen’s Gambit </em>star, she got two nods for the coveted award presented by Hollywood Foreign Press Association. She also vied for the Golden Globe for best actress in a motion picture musical or comedy for <em>Emma</em>. The award in that category went to <strong>Rosamund Pike </strong>for <em>I Care a Lot</em>.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>A LONG WAY FROM <em>ATLANTIS</em></strong><br />The Golden Globe win is a big accomplishment for Taylor-Joy, who now has earned 11 awards and 26 nominations since her debut in the 2015 fantasy series <em>Atlantis</em>. Accolades started to roll in that same year with <em>The Witch</em>, a period horror film that won the actress nine film festival prizes. Other recent movies that have brought her recognition are <em>Glass</em>, <em>Marrowbone</em>, and <em>Thoroughbreds</em>.</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or’s Golden Globe was one of two awards for the series she leads. <em>The Queen’s Gambit </em>also took home the prize for best television limited series or motion picture made for television.&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The awards night also featured a few other Latino stars, including actresses <strong>Rosie Perez </strong>and <strong>Salma Hayek</strong>, who were presenters, as well as <strong>Lin-Manuel Miranda</strong>, whose <em>Hamilton</em> musical film was nominated in two categories—for best musical or comedy motion picture and for best actor.&nbsp;&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><strong>JANE FONDA’S MESSAGE</strong><br />One of the biggest highlights of the event was the speech delivered by actress <strong>Jane Fonda </strong>while accepting the Cecil B. DeMille Award, honoring the outstanding contributions to the world of entertainment. Her subject: diversity in Hollywood.</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ignleft size-large is-resized"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/03/NUP_193336_0125-768x460.jpg" alt="" class="wp-image-60785" width="491" height="294"/><figcaption>Jane Fonda walks onstage to accept the Cecil B. DeMille Award at the 78th Annual Golden Globe Awards on February 28, 2021. Photo: NBC</figcaption></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">&#8220;You know, we are a community of storytellers, aren&#8217;t we?,&#8221; said the <em>On Golden Pond </em>actress. &#8220;And in turbulent, crisis-torn times like these, storytelling has always been essential.&#8221;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Fonda talked about the power of stories and art to change hearts and minds and acknowledged the challenges one sometimes faces to understand people of diverse backgrounds at work and life. &#8220;But inevitably, if my heart is open, and I look beneath the surface, I feel kinship,” she said and called for more inclusivity in film and Hollywood.&nbsp;<br /></p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y stands out as one of two actresses with double nominations of the prestigious Golden Globes this year.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The 24-year-old actress of Argentine descent competes in the best actress in a comedy feature category for her leading role in <em>Emma</em>, where she faces off against Oscar-nominated and past Golden Globe winners <strong>Michelle Pfeiffer </strong>(<em>French Exit</em>) and <strong>Kate Hudson </strong>(<em>Music</em>). </p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y is also nominated for best actress for the limited television series <em>The Queen’s Gambit</em>, facing off against <strong>Cate Blanchett </strong>(<em>Mrs. America</em>) and <strong>Nicole Kidman </strong>(<em>The Undoing</em>), both multiple Oscar- and Golden Globe-winning stars.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y is a first-time nominee for a Golden Globe.</p>


<figure class="wp-block-embed is-type-video is-provider-youtube wp-block-embed-youtube wp-embed-aspect-16-9 wp-has-aspect-ratio"><div class="wp-block-embed__wrapper">
https://youtu.be/CDrieqwSdgI
</div></figure>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">However, the drama about an orphaned, chess prodigy is not the only Latino-led episodic competing this year for the coveted award from the Hollywood Foreign Press Association.&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Disney’s <em>The Mandalorian</em>, starring Chilean-born actor <strong>Pedro Pascal</strong>, is also nominated for best television drama series. The sci-fi western episodic from the <em>Star Wars </em>universe competes against <em>The Crown</em>, <em>Lovecraft Country</em>, <em>Ozark</em>, and <em>Ratched</em>.</p>


<figure class="wp-block-embed is-type-video is-provider-youtube wp-block-embed-youtube wp-embed-aspect-16-9 wp-has-aspect-ratio"><div class="wp-block-embed__wrapper">
<iframe title="The Mandalorian | Official Trailer | Disney+ | Streaming Nov. 12" width="640" height="360"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/aOC8E8z_ifw?feature=oembed" frameborder="0" allow="accelerometer; autoplay; clipboard-write; encrypted-media; gyroscope; picture-in-picture; web-share" referrerpolicy="strict-origin-when-cross-origin" allowfullscreen></iframe>
</div></figure>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><em>Hamilton</em>, the film that captured the live performance of the acclaimed Broadway musical by Lin-Manuel Miranda featuring the original cast, also received two nominations, for best musical or comedy motion picture. The feature about America&#8217;s Founding Father Alexander Hamilton competes against <em>Borat Subsequent Moviefilm</em>, <em>Music</em>, <em>Palm Springs</em>, and <em>The Prom</em>. Miranda, who stars in the film, is also a contender for best actor, along with <strong>Sacha Baron Cohen </strong>(<em>Borat Subsequent Moviefilm</em>), <strong>James Corden </strong>(<em>The Prom</em>), <strong>Dev Patel </strong>(<em>The Personal History of David Copperfield</em>), and <strong>Andy Samberg </strong>(<em>Palm Springs</em>).</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">This will be Miranda’s third Golden Globes nomination. His first two nominations were for best original song for the animated series <em>Moana </em>and later for his acting in <em>Mary Poppins Returns</em>.</p>


<figure class="wp-block-embed is-type-video is-provider-youtube wp-block-embed-youtube wp-embed-aspect-16-9 wp-has-aspect-ratio"><div class="wp-block-embed__wrapper">
<iframe title="Hamilton | Official Trailer | Disney+" width="640" height="360"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/DSCKfXpAGHc?feature=oembed" frameborder="0" allow="accelerometer; autoplay; clipboard-write; encrypted-media; gyroscope; picture-in-picture; web-share" referrerpolicy="strict-origin-when-cross-origin" allowfullscreen></iframe>
</div></figure>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">In the foreign language film category, the Spanish-language horror flick <em>La Llorona </em>from Guatemala competes against Denmark’s <em>Another Round</em>, Italy’s <em>The Life Ahead</em>, France’s <em>Two of Us</em>, and U.S.A.’s Korean-language dramedy <em>Minari</em>.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><em>La Llorona </em>is a supernatural drama about an aging war criminal facing death and ghosts of his past. Directed by <strong>Jayro Bustamante </strong>(<em>Temblores</em>), the film is also Guatemala’s official entry for the Oscars this year.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The 78th edition of the Golden Globes will take place on Feb. 28 and air on NBC. Hosting the awards will be comedic actresses <strong>Tina Fey</strong> (<em>30 Rock</em>) and <strong>Amy Poehler</strong> (<em>Inside Out</em>) repeating that feat for the fourth time. Fey will be live from New York, and Poehler will be live from Beverly Hills. Nominees will join in live from various locations around the world.</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Actresses <strong>Zoe Saldana </strong>and <strong>Anya Taylor-Joy </strong>are part of the illustrious list of actors who have signed on to Oscar-nominated director <strong>David O. Russell</strong>’s (<em>American Hustle</em>) new “untitled film” currently filming in Los Angeles.&nbsp;</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ignright size-large is-resized"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/01/Zoe_Saldana_Cannes_2013-Creative-Commons-325x460.jpg" alt="" class="wp-image-59567" width="306" height="433"/><figcaption>Zoe Saldana in Cannes <br />(Photo: Creative Commons)</figcaption></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The incredible list of actors attached to this project, is a literal who’s who of Hollywood heavyweights, a comedic legend, and some of Hollywood’s hottest talents.&nbsp; The list includes:&nbsp; Academy award-winning actor <strong>Robert De Niro</strong> and the versatile <strong>Christian Bale</strong>.&nbsp; They join two comedic legends and <em>Saturday Night Live</em> alumni <strong>Chris Rock </strong>and <strong>Mike Meyers</strong>. Academy Award winner <strong>Rami Malek</strong>, <strong>Margot Robbie</strong>, and <strong>John David Washington</strong> were some of the first actors cast last year.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Saldana is best known for her roles in multiple major Hollywood action and sci-fi film franchises. Her first major franchise role was as Anamaria in <em>Pirates of the Caribbean: The Curse of the Black Pearl</em>. In 2009, Saldana starred in two of the biggest contemporary franchises to date, first in the reboot of <em>Star Trek</em> as Uhura and second and most notably as Neytiri in <em>Avatar</em>.&nbsp; Saldana is set to reprise her role of Neytiri in four more of the upcoming <em>Avatar</em> sequels, two of which have already been filmed with two more in production.</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Taylor-Joy, the Argentine-British actress, gained acting notoriety in the chilling horror film <em>The Witch</em> as the lead Thomasin. She was a regular in the Netflix TV series <em>The Dark Crystal: Age of Resistance</em>, the BBC’s <em>Atlantis</em>, and HBO Max’s <em>Peaky Blinders</em>. However it was her magnetic performance in the lead role as Beth Harmon in the Netflix&nbsp;wildly popular limited series <em>The Queen’s Gambit </em>that has put her acting career in full throttle.</p>


<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="alignleft size-large is-resized"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" src="https://staging.latinheat.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/01/emmanuel-lubezki-Kimberley-French-Twentieth-Century-Fox-459x460.jpg" alt="" class="wp-image-59370" width="274" height="274"/><figcaption>Cinematographer Emmanuel Lubezki <br />(Photo: Kimberley French 20th Century FOX)</figcaption></figure></div>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Russell has also brought on board one of the most notable cinematographers in the business, Mexican born <strong>Emmanuel Lubezki</strong>, who has gained international notoriety for his breathtaking visuals. Among Lubezki’s highest awards are three Oscars and three BAFTA awards, won three years in a row, for <em>Gravity</em>, <em>Birdman</em>, and <em>The Revenant</em>.&nbsp;&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">It takes a three-time, Oscar nominated director with Russell’s track record of films like <em>American Hustle</em>, <em>Silver Lining Playbook</em>, and <em>Three Kings</em> to pull together such a noted cast for one film.&nbsp;&nbsp;</p>


<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Not much has been revealed about the storyline of this film, other than it is a comedy written by Russell, based on an original idea of his.</p>
